Abstract
The effects of the Pr3+ concentration on the excitation and emission spectra of Pr3+ in (La1−xPrx)2O3, (RE1−x)Prx2O2S (RE = Y, La) (x ⩽0.2), and LiY1−xPrxF4(x⩽0.1) are investigated. Concentration enhancement of vibronic transitions and of certain zero-phonon transitions is observed for the excitation spectrum of Pr3+ in (La1−xPrx)2O3 and (RE1−xPrx)2O2S. These phenomena can be ascribed to superexchange interaction between Pr3+ ions over distances of about 10 Å.
